Ok, here are the results:

1. With JSF 1.2_04 and JDK 1.5.0_09-b01 - there is NO exceptions.
2. With JSF 1.2_07 and JDK 1.5.0_09-b01 - there is this exception :(

It's very sad, because I can't work with JSF 1.2_04 because my App uses JBoss RichFaces version which needs JSF 1.2_07 for bugless work.
